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, beat together 1/2 cup butter, 1/2 cup peanut but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y, about 2 minutes.
  3. Beat in eg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add to the wet mixture, mixing until just combined. Do not overmix.
  5. Roll dough into 1-inch balls and place 2 inches apart on prepared baking sheets. Flatten each ball with a fork in a crisscross pattern.
  6.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until edges are lightly golden. C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  7. For the filling: In a medium bowl, beat together 1/2 cup peanut butter, powdered sugar, and 2 tablespoons butter until smooth. Add milk, 1 tablespoon at a time, until spreadable consistency.
  8. Spread about 1 tablespoon of filling onto the flat side of one cookie, then top with another cookie to form a sandwich. Repeat with remaining cookies.
  9.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days.
